Mumbai to Rameshwaram 6-Day Itinerary

Thursday, November 30: Mumbai

In the morning, start your trip in Mumbai by visiting the iconic Gateway of India, a historical landmark overlooking the Arabian Sea. Afterward, explore the bustling markets of Colaba Causeway, where you can shop for souvenirs and taste local street food. In the afternoon, visit the Chhatrapati Shivaji Terminus, a UNESCO World Heritage Site renowned for its stunning architecture. As the evening sets in, take a relaxing stroll along Marine Drive, also known as the "Queen's Necklace," and admire the beautiful sunset.

  • Gateway of India: Cost estimate - INR 30, Time spent - 1 hour
  • Colaba Causeway: Cost estimate - Variable, Time spent - 2 hours
  • Chhatrapati Shivaji Terminus: Cost estimate - INR 15, Time spent - 1 hour
  • Marine Drive: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
Friday, December 1: Mahabaleshwar

In the morning, head to Mahabaleshwar, a beautiful hill station located in the Western Ghats. Start your day by exploring the scenic viewpoints of Arthur's Seat and Wilson Point, which offer panoramic views of the surrounding valleys and mountains. Afterward, visit the picturesque Venna Lake, where you can enjoy boating and indulge in delicious strawberries, a local specialty. In the evening, take a leisurely walk through the lively market streets of Mahabaleshwar and browse through handicrafts and souvenirs.

  • Arthur's Seat: Cost estimate - INR 50,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Wilson Point: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Venna Lake: Cost estimate - Boating charges apply,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Market streets of Mahabaleshwar: Cost estimate - Variable, Time spent - 2-3 hours
Saturday, December 2: Goa

Spend your morning in Goa by visiting the famous Basilica of Bom Jesus, a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for the preserved body of Saint Francis Xavier. Explore the vibrant neighborhoods of Fontainhas and Panjim, where you can admire the colorful Portuguese architecture and try Goan delicacies. In the afternoon, relax on the beautiful beaches of Calangute and Baga, and take part in water sports activities if desired. As the evening approaches, witness the enchanting sunset at the Chapora Fort, offering breathtaking views of the Arabian Sea.

  • Basilica of Bom Jesus: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Fontainhas and Panjim: Cost estimate - Variable,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Calangute and Baga Beaches: Cost estimate - Variable,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Chapora Fort: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
Sunday, December 3: Kanyakumari

In the morning, travel to Kanyakumari, the southernmost point of the Indian mainland. Start your day by visiting the Vivekananda Rock Memorial, a monument dedicated to Swami Vivekananda. Take a ferry to reach the memorial and enjoy the serene surroundings. Afterward, explore the Kanyakumari Temple, a sacred site dedicated to the goddess Devi Kanyakumari. In the afternoon, relax on the pristine beaches of Kanyakumari and witness the unique phenomenon of the confluence of the Arabian Sea, Indian Ocean, and Bay of Bengal. As the evening sets in, don't miss the mesmerizing sunset view from the Vivekananda Rock Memorial.

  • Vivekananda Rock Memorial: Cost estimate - Ferry charges apply,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Kanyakumari Temple: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Kanyakumari Beaches: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Sunset at Vivekananda Rock Memorial: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 1 hour
Monday, December 4: Madurai

Begin your day in Madurai by visiting the famous Meenakshi Amman Temple, a stunning Hindu temple known for its intricately carved gopurams (pyramidal towers). Explore the temple complex and witness the elaborate rituals and ceremonies. In the afternoon, visit the Thirumalai Nayakkar Palace, a 17th-century palace showcasing a fusion of Dravidian and Islamic architectural styles. As the evening approaches, explore the lively streets of the Madurai market and indulge in local delicacies like Jigarthanda and Paruthi Paal.

  • Meenakshi Amman Temple: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Thirumalai Nayakkar Palace: Cost estimate - INR 50,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Madurai Market: Cost estimate - Variable, Time spent - 2-3 hours
Tuesday, December 5: Rameshwaram

Spend your last day in Rameshwaram exploring the sacred sites of this pilgrimage town. Begin your day by visiting the Ramanathaswamy Temple, one of the twelve Jyotirlinga temples devoted to Lord Shiva. Take a dip in the holy Agni Theertham and perform rituals at the temple. Afterward, visit the Dhanushkodi Beach, located at the tip of the Indian subcontinent, where you can relax and enjoy the pristine beauty of the coastline. In the evening, witness the famous Pamban Bridge opening at specific times to let boats pass, offering a unique sight.

  • Ramanathaswamy Temple: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Dhanushkodi Beach: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Pamban Bridge: Cost estimate - Free, Time spent - 1 hour

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While on your journey, make sure to explore the hidden gems and local favorites. In Mumbai, don't miss the small bustling streets of Crawford Market, where you can find a variety of spices, fabrics, and jewelry. In Mahabaleshwar, visit the hilltop temple of Krishnabai for stunning views and tranquility. In Goa, venture into the secluded Butterfly Beach, known for its pristine natural beauty. In Kanyakumari, explore the serene Padmanabhapuram Palace, showcasing the traditional Kerala architectural style. In Madurai, take a stroll through the colorful flower market near the Temple complex. Finally, in Rameshwaram, visit the ghost town of Dhanushkodi, which was destroyed in a cyclone in 1964.
